Cocora Valley (Valle de Cocora)

Family-Friendly view of Cocora Valley (Valle de Cocora) in , Quindío

Why Visit?

Welcome to the enchanting Cocora Valley, a must-visit spectacle of nature located in the heart of Colombia"s coffee region, best known for its towering wax palm trees, the tallest in the world and Colombia"s national tree.

Day 1: Arrival and Exploration

- Start at Salento: Cocora Valley is most accessible from the quaint town of Salento. If you’re coming from further afield, you can take a bus from Armenia or Pereira, which are connected to major cities by bus and air routes. From Salento, catch one of the colorful Willys jeeps from the main square, which leave when full and take about 30 minutes to reach the valley.

- Hiking Adventure: Once at Cocora, choose the 5-hour loop trail which starts by crossing a bridge and takes you through the cloud forest, past rivers, and the hummingbird sanctuary, ideal for a quick rest and to learn about these mesmerizing birds. Ensure you"re prepared with good walking shoes, water, and snacks.

Day 2: The Wax Palm Forest and More

- Morning Walk among the Palms: Start early to avoid crowds and head straight to the valley floor to marvel at the wax palms. These palms can grow up to 60 meters tall and live for more than 100 years! The morning mist often creates a mystical atmosphere.

- Picnic Lunch: Pack a lunch and enjoy a family picnic amidst the gentle giants. There’s plenty of space for children to run around and play.

- Horseback Riding: In the afternoon, take a horseback tour. It’s an enjoyable way for the family to explore without tiring out the little ones. Local guides, often found at the entrance, will offer tours that provide different perspectives of the valley.

Interesting Facts:

1. The Cocora Valley is part of the larger Los Nevados National Natural Park.

2. The valley is not only about the palms; it"s also a great place for bird watching, with many endemic species.
